Moving Costs in Belvedere Park, GA
Local moves near Decatur and the greater Atlanta metro are billed hourly, with the total depending mainly on crew size and how much you are moving.
| Crew / Fee | Typical Cost |
|---|---|
| 2-mover crew, hourly | $150 - $200 |
| 3-mover crew, hourly | $220 - $300 |
| Total local move | $400 - $3,400+ |
| Travel / fuel fee | $100 - $150 |
Most companies add that travel or fuel fee to cover the drive from their warehouse to your home and back - ask whether it is separate from the hourly clock before you book. That clock typically keeps running through loading, the drive to your new address, and unloading, stopping only once everything is inside and paperwork is signed. Packing your own clothes, books, and other non-fragile items ahead of time can meaningfully cut labor hours. Standard liability coverage required by law is thin, about $0.60 per pound per article, so a broken 50-pound television nets roughly $30 unless you upgrade to full value protection. Narrow parking, steep stairs, or a tight elevator will slow the crew down, so flag those details when you book rather than on moving day.

Who's moving to Belvedere Park, GA
Federal tax-filer migration data for DeKalb County.
64% arrived from elsewhere in Georgia. Most arrivals are in-state moves, so a regional company will usually cover it — check interstate authority only if you're crossing a state line.
See licensed movers63% of departures stayed under 50 miles. Short local moves are usually priced by the hour, so a regional company is often the cheaper call.

Households arriving from another state report $71,388 in average annual income; those relocating from elsewhere in Georgia report $67,017. Long-distance arrivals are the higher-budget half of the market.
How this works: IRS SOI County-to-County Migration Data, 2022-2023. The IRS compares the address on consecutive tax returns, so every move here is a real filed household. The catch: it publishes annually with about a two-year lag, counts DeKalb County rather than city limits exactly, misses people who don't file a return, and leaves 13% of moves unattributed to a specific county, because flows too small to publish are grouped into regional buckets instead.
